Примеры ответов Нейро на вопросы из разных сфер
Главная / Технологии / Как работает технология рендеринга 3D моделей в современных онлайн играх?
Вопрос для Нейро
20 марта

Как работает технология рендеринга 3D моделей в современных онлайн играх?

Нейро
На основе 5 источников

Технология рендеринга 3D-моделей в современных онлайн-играх работает с помощью специальной программы, которая переводит модели и сцены в плоское изображение. 1

Процесс начинается с того, что каждая сцена и модель, созданная автором, содержит математические данные. 1 Эти данные поэтапно обрабатываются и преобразуются в изображение. 1 В процессе модели «обрастают» подробностями: появляются чёткие линии контура, цвет и оттенки, модели начинают отбрасывать тени и отражаться согласно законам физики. 1

Некоторые методы рендеринга и их особенности:

  • Растеризация. 15 Модель делится на большое количество полигонов с помощью сетки. 1 Вершины полигонов содержат информацию о цвете, текстуре и расположении. 1 При запуске рендеринга вершины проецируются перпендикулярно камере на пустую плоскость. 1
  • Рейкастинг. 15 Из точки наблюдения к объектам сцены направляются лучи, определяющие цвет пикселей на экране. 5 В отличие от более сложной трассировки лучей, рейкастинг не учитывает дополнительные эффекты, такие как отражения или преломления, но позволяет достичь естественного эффекта перспективы. 5
  • Трассировка лучей. 15 Углубляет визуализацию, позволяя лучам света интерактивно взаимодействовать с объектами сцены. 5 Этот метод создаёт изображения с высоким уровнем реализма за счёт точного моделирования отражений, теней и преломлений, однако требует значительных вычислительных мощностей. 5
  • Трассировка пути. 5 Один из самых продвинутых методов рендеринга, максимально приближённых к физическим законам распространения света. 5 Трассировка пути обеспечивает исключительную фотореалистичность, хотя и является наиболее ресурсоёмкой техникой. 5

Для плавной работы интерактивной сцены или игры 3D-движок должен обрабатывать изображение не менее 20–25 кадров в секунду. 1 Чтобы обеспечить такую скорость, разработчики рекомендуют максимально оптимизировать процесс, например, снижать нагрузку на процессор или качество 3D-моделей и текстур. 1

0
Ответ сформирован YandexGPT на основе текстов выбранных сайтов. В нём могут быть неточности.
Примеры полезных ответов Нейро на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Нейро.
Задать новый вопрос
Задайте вопрос...
…и сразу получите ответ в Поиске с Нейро
Войдите, чтобы поставить лайк
С Яндекс ID это займёт пару секунд
Войти
Tue Jun 17 2025 10:03:28 GMT+0300 (Moscow Standard Time)